To estimate a quotient, you can use a process called rounding. Here are the steps to estimate a quotient:

1. Identify the dividend and the divisor. The dividend is the number being divided, and the divisor is the number you are dividing by.

2. Round the dividend and divisor to a convenient number. For example, if you have 456 divided by 7, you could round 456 to 460 and 7 to 10.

3. Divide the rounded dividend by the rounded divisor. In our example, 460 divided by 10 is equal to 46.

So, the estimated quotient of 456 divided by 7 is approximately 46. Keep in mind that this is just an estimation, and the actual quotient may differ slightly.
